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/MHSanaei/3x-ui.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Ali Rahimi <alirahimi818@gmail.com>2025-01-23 23:33:47 +0300
committerGitHub <noreply@github.com>2025-01-23 23:33:47 +0300
commit04cf250a547bb64265d256e7d15af7cea5ecfa67 (patch)
tree9d4ef49eca76d9c4c2860566c075b67b4117aaa8
parentac9ab828b541839c1ccd10045ceca8f2f9bb4957 (diff)
json post base path bug fixed (#2647)
* json post base path bug fixed * added comment field to group client management
-rw-r--r--web/assets/js/util/utils.js2
-rw-r--r--web/html/xui/client_modal.html3
2 files changed, 3 insertions, 2 deletions
diff --git a/web/assets/js/util/utils.js b/web/assets/js/util/utils.js
index 28ec95c7..10825490 100644
--- a/web/assets/js/util/utils.js
+++ b/web/assets/js/util/utils.js
@@ -81,7 +81,7 @@ class HttpUtil {
},
body: JSON.stringify(data),
};
- const resp = await fetch(url, requestOptions);
+ const resp = await fetch(basePath + url.replace(/^\/+|\/+$/g, ''), requestOptions);
const response = await resp.json();
msg = this._respToMsg({data : response});
diff --git a/web/html/xui/client_modal.html b/web/html/xui/client_modal.html
index de7915a5..ef4e14a1 100644
--- a/web/html/xui/client_modal.html
+++ b/web/html/xui/client_modal.html
@@ -36,12 +36,13 @@
ok() {
if (app.subSettings.enable && clientModal.group.isGroup && clientModal.group.canGroup) {
const currentClient = clientModal.group.currentClient;
- const { limitIp, totalGB, expiryTime, reset, enable, subId, tgId, flow } = currentClient;
+ const { limitIp, comment, totalGB, expiryTime, reset, enable, subId, tgId, flow } = currentClient;
const uniqueEmails = clientModalApp.makeGroupEmailsUnique(clientModal.dbInbounds, currentClient.email, clientModal.group.clients);
clientModal.group.clients.forEach((client, index) => {
client.email = uniqueEmails[index];
client.limitIp = limitIp;
+ client.comment = comment;
client.totalGB = totalGB;
client.expiryTime = expiryTime;
client.reset = reset;